Summary of the contracting process

The Wirral Borough Council has concluded the tender process titled "Wirral Children and Young People 'Risk and Resilience'; Risk Taking/Health Related Behaviours Offer" under the health and social work services category. This procurement process, which followed a competitive dialogue method, sought to develop a consistent and evidence-based approach to enhance resilience and reduce risk among children and young people. The final award was granted to Wirral Community Health and Care NHS Foundation Trust, with a contract valued at £3,381,948, covering the period from 1st September 2024 to 31st August 2031. This procurement initiative primarily targeted England as its delivery region.

Notice Description

A consistent, evidence-based, and practical approach will be developed to promote resilience and reduce vulnerability to risk and the consequences of risk-taking behaviours across the full range of needs for children and young people. An holistic approach is essential to ensure that these risks/challenges are not considered in isolation resulting in siloed services which result in children and young people being passed between services.
